Analysis

The most recent figure for netherlands (kingdom of the) — veneer sheets — import quantity in Estonia is 4 m3, measured in 2018.

Compared with earlier readings it is up 100.0% on the previous year and down 90.2% over ten years.

Over the whole period, netherlands (kingdom of the) — veneer sheets — import quantity in Estonia peaked at 41 m3 in 2004 and was at its lowest, 1 m3, in 2002.

Estonia ranks 45th of 53 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.

The database contains data on the bilateral trade flows in roundwood, prim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world. The main types of primary forest products included in are: ro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further. The definitions are available.
